Why Your Business Should Choose a Virtual Office in Ashburn, VA

Ashburn, located in Loudoun County, Virginia, is a bustling town known for its vibrant community and thriving economy. As part of the Washington Metropolitan Area, Ashburn offers a strategic location for businesses looking to establish a presence in the region. With its proximity to major transportation hubs and a highly educated workforce, it's no surprise that Ashburn has become a sought-after destination for entrepreneurs and corporations alike.
For those in need of a professional workspace without the commitment of a traditional office lease, a virtual office in Ashburn presents a practical solution. Whether you're a freelancer, startup, or small business, a virtual office provides an affordable way to establish a prestigious address, access essential business services, and create a professional image for your company.
